This a reminder that STAAR Assessments begin on Tuesday, April 25th, and end on May 10th. For Irons to successfully administer the STAAR assessment, we need all students to attend and arrive at school by 8:50 on the day of the assessments. Any student arriving late will still be required to take the assessment, but we must move the student to an alternate testing room. If your child is absent from testing, they will make up the assessment on the make-up days. You can find more information about the schedule below.

Instruction:
In two weeks, students will be participating in the redesigned State of Texas Assessments of Academic Readiness (STAAR®). The redesigned STAAR will allow our students to show in different ways what they have learned this year. The assessments for each grade level include:
- Grade 7 - Reading Language Art & Math
- Grade 8 - Reading Language Arts, Science, Social Studies, & Math

Conroe ISD Bond Information:
Conroe ISD requested the participation of students, parents, business owners, community members, and employees for a Bond Planning Committee (BPC) in anticipation of a bond on the November 7, 2023, ballot. The District is experiencing unprecedented growth and seeks the guidance of stakeholders. Over 360 submissions were received through the interest form. Of those, 160 were selected to represent a cross-section of our great District.
